Home > Doc > Come Creare un Expert di Metastock > La funzione Alert

Come Creare un Expert di Metastock

La funzione Alert

Ora dobbiamo integrare il sistema con il raggiungimento da parte del RSI a valori di ipervenduto ipercomprato e sono rispettivamente 30 e 70.

La funzione del Relative Streng Index è :

rsi(14)

dove 14 sono I periodi

Per unire questa funzione con quella precedente usiamo l'operatore booleano AND

Quindi se si incrocia la media a 8 con la 21 periodi e l'RSI ha raggiunto il valore di 30 si traduce con

Cross(Mov(c,21,s),Mov(c,8,s))

and

Cross(70, rsi(14))

Questa istruzione ci fornisce quindi un segnale se contemporaneamente all'incrocio delle medie l'RSI raggiunge il valore di 70punti. Una condizione di questo tipo è certamente molto rara , magari si verifica il giono prima o due giorni dopo.

Per fare in modo che il segnale si attivi anche dopo un certo periodo di tempo si utilizza il comando alert la cui sintassi è:

alert(condizione,periodo)

La nostra condizione è l'RSI a 70 punti e come periodo impostiamo 10 giorni, quindi la formula si completa in questo modo :

alert(Cross(70, rsi(14)),10))

ed integrata con la precedente :

per long :

Cross(Mov(c,21,s),Mov(c,8,s))

and

alert(Cross(70, rsi(14)),10))

per Short :

Cross(Mov(c,8,s),Mov(c,21,s))

and

alert(Cross(30, rsi(14)),10))

il grafico che si ottiene è il seguente :

Attenzione che il sistema sperimentato ha il solo scopo di esempio e non produce risultati positivi

Ivan Degiovanni

Sommario: Index